Summary: 
The rate-distortion optimization (RDO) method is an informative technology that improves the coding efficiency, but increases the computational complexity, of the H.264 encoder. In this letter, a fast Macroblock mode determination algorithm is proposed to reduce the computational complexity of the H.264 encoder. The proposed method reduces the encoder complexity by 55%, while maintaining the same level of coding efficiency.
